Mark 6:46-48

Geneva(i) 46 Then assoone as he had sent them away, he departed into a mountaine to pray. 47 And when euen was come, the ship was in the mids of the sea, and he alone on the land. 48 And he saw them troubled in rowing, (for the winde was contrary vnto them) and about the fourth watch of the night, hee came vnto them, walking vpon the sea, and would haue passed by them.
